First we had injections, then we had pills. Now, Novo Nordisk has signed a deal with Californian biotech Vivani Medical to evaluate a semaglutide implant.
In its latest move to regain the initiative against rival Eli Lilly in the GLP-1 wars, Novo will assess NPM-139, a semaglutide implant for chronic weight management that Vivani has developed using its NanoPortal platform technology.
